// Compression note for Pipeline Relay plugin clients:
// permessage-deflate is ON by default. Saves ~60% bandwidth on chatty
// streams, costs CPU and adds per-frame latency. Disable it for
// high-frequency small messages; keep it for bulk sync. Context takeover
// is off — memory stays flat, ratios suffer slightly.
// The client below needs the relay's internal key, which is next.

gateway credential: kto23_LX9A4ys6i4nzHtpOLNLodKK

## Escalation — StageView Seat-Map Renderer

So the renderer for the Marbury Playhouse seat maps is flaky under load, especially right when a big show goes on sale. If seats render as blank tiles or the zoom view hangs, don't push the release anyway — patrons will buy the wrong seats and the box office will riot. Roll back to the last tagged build, ping the StageView channel, and if nobody bites within twenty minutes, escalate using the address below.

escalation mailbox, yafog-kafof: eliok@xolmarcloud.local

Pool car keys — grab yours from the cabinet! Before you head out on your first site visit for Quillbrook, swing by the kitchenette corridor on level 2. The grey key cabinet next to the noticeboard holds all the pool-car fobs. Sign the clipboard (yes, we still use paper), take the key tagged for your booking, and pop it back by end of day. The cabinet won't open without a pass, so use the one below.

door code, kawip-bagap: bdg-HQEWH-4

## Releases

Welcome aboard! Quieten, our on-call alert deduplicator, ships every other Thursday. We cut a tag from main, run the smoke suite against the Farwick staging cluster, and push artifacts to the internal registry. If you're doing the release, ping whoever's on rotation first — usually Marla or Deet — so nobody double-cuts. Hotfixes skip the schedule but still need a signed build; unsigned tarballs get rejected at deploy time, no exceptions. To verify any release artifact locally, use the current signing key below.

signing key of yagug-bawif = bky9_cvCf6ehGp